About the role

  • Senior Mechanical Engineer supporting radar development programs at Raytheon. Leading mechanical teams from concept development through design, build and test phases in Massachusetts.

Responsibilities

  • Utilizing strong mechanical hardware design experience and knowledge with ruggedized structures, interconnects, cooling, electronics packaging and/or array integration
  • Developing technical solutions to a wide range of complex problems related to the entire product life cycle including proposal, design, manufacture, integration and test of phase array radars/electronics for multiple military programs
  • Supervising the definitions of mechanical outline and construction details, component selection and specification, mechanical and assembly drawings, electrical/RF layout, and delivering the final technical data package
  • Employing transition-to-production practices with the ability to lead a design release into production
  • Work with limited supervision and meet commitments for assigned schedule, financial, and technical goals with ability to make enhancements and leverage in daily work
  • Preparing proposal inputs on behalf of the product area
  • Providing technical conscience, challenged with making sure the product and process meet appropriate standards and requirements while helping to remove roadblocks
  • Perform complex tolerance analyses to ensure form, fit, and function are as intended by design for the use-application.
  • Interacting frequently with senior personnel, occasionally including external customers, on significant technical matters often requiring coordination between organizations.
